What are the opposite words for most singled-out?
The phrase "most singled-out" means the most targeted or highlighted. Its antonyms could be "unnoticed," "unremarkable," "unnoticed," or "overlooked." When something is unnoticed, it doesn't attract attention or recognition. When it is unremarkable, it is considered ordinary or average, and when it is overlooked, it is ignored or missed. Therefore, if someone or something is not singled-out, they are simply part of the crowd, not drawing any special attention.
